NVIDIA Quantum Benchmarks Suite v0.5.0 is released! #187
fmozafari
announced in
Announcements
Replies: 0 comments
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Uh oh!
There was an error while loading. Please reload this page.
Uh oh!
There was an error while loading. Please reload this page.
-
We are excited to announce the release of NVIDIA Quantum Performance Benchmark Suite v0.5.0 🚀 , bringing new features and improvements for quantum simulation benchmarking.
New Features & Enhancements
The suite formerly known as
cuquantum-benchmarksis now renamed tonv-quantum-benchmarks.CUDA-Q (cudaq) is now available as both a frontend and backend.
Newly supported frontend and backends include:
--frontend: cudaq--backend: cudaq-cusv, cudaq-mgpu, cudaq-cpuThe
--compute-modeargument is now available for all backends.Modes include:
Note: Not all backends support every compute mode, and each backend has its own default.
New arguments for customizing Pauli strings in your benchmarks:
--pauli-string: Directly specify the desired Pauli string.--pauli-seed: Set a seed for generating random Pauli strings.--pauli-identity-fraction: Control the fraction of identity operators when creating random Pauli strings.The Quantum Approximate Optimization Algorithm (QAOA) benchmark now selects gammas and betas randomly for more diverse tests.
Extensive code refactoring and cleanup for better maintainability and extensibility.
Installation Instructions
Same as in the previous release, it can be easily installed by cloning this repository as follows:
This benchmark suite works either without or with our cuQuantum Appliance container. For further information, please see the benchmark project README.
Happy benchmarking with NVIDIA Quantum Performance Benchmark Suite v0.5.0!
Beta Was this translation helpful? Give feedback.
All reactions